Dantewada is a town in southern Chhattisgarh, named after the major temple in the area, Danteshwari Temple.

  • 1 Danteshwari Temple. LIterally meaning "Teeth Goddess", according to legend this is where the teeth of the Hindu goddess Sati fell. Danteshwari Temple (Q5221212) on Wikidata Danteshwari Temple on Wikipedia OSM directions Apple Maps directions (beta) Google Maps directions
